An attorney can look at your work agreement and area of job to identify whether you qualify for benefits. Lomita Lawyer Workers Comp. By legislation, Pennsylvania employers are needed to pay for workers' settlement coverage for all certified workers.

Also if you have actually been authorized for benefits, your employer or its insurance policy company might attempt to get you reviewed to see whether your injury has actually come to be much less serious. Lomita Lawyer Workers Comp. This is called an independent clinical assessment (IME), and it may be done by a business physician to reveal that your injury no more exists or is not as extreme
In Pennsylvania, for the first 90 days after an injury, you need to see a physician authorized by your employer or its insurance policy business. Yet this is just the instance if your company blog posts a list of a minimum of 6 accepted clinical suppliers and meets other requirements. Frequently, there is complication regarding whether you do require to see an accepted medical company or whether you have a lot more alternatives.
Even if you endure a major head injury, symptoms might not emerge for hours or days. This can make it more challenging to verify a details injury is connected to work. It can also indicate a first clinical assessment will certainly establish you were not seriously hurt. An employees' compensation attorney understands not all injuries present signs immediately.
